[pango] (61 commits) Non-fast-forward update to branch wip/baedert/for-master



The branch 'wip/baedert/for-master' was changed in a way that was not a fast-forward update.
NOTE: This may cause problems for people pulling from the branch. For more information,
please see:

 https://wiki.gnome.org/Git/Help/NonFastForward

Commits removed from the branch:

  2ec0b48... layout: Ignore setting the width if it won't have any effec
  156d069... pangocairo-context: Don't invalidate if font options are eq
  f69dffe... layout: Try to avoid some work when creating iters
  4580160... Allocate internal PangoAttrListIterators on the stack
  1302af4... layotu: Avoid invalidating when setting attrs from NULL to 
  1a6dc92... layout: Add missing (nullable) annotation
  0f40de6... Allocate internal PangoAttrLists on the stack
  da2fccc... layout: Avoid getting the text length if we know it already
  9a0623f... attributes: Add _pango_attr_list_has_attributes
  dcfb8ba... break_attrs: Bail out if we have no ALLOW_BREAKS attributes
  4042985... break: Make a local const
  52e9f38... break: Only call break_attrs if we really have attributes
  86e082e... glyph-item: Allocate attr iterator on the stack
  c41ba6a... testattributes: Properly free GString
  c8a6890... attrs: Save iterator stack in a GPtrArray
  ee240f1... attrlist: Remove attributes_tail
  a331922... attrs: Save attribute list in a GPtrArray
  3fb73a9... testattributes: Test iter on empty attr list
  8ee0a4f... pango-layout: Try to avoid allocating a new PangoAttrList
  4d782aa... layout: Unconditionally unref attr lists
  46e6994... test-common: Ignore null attr lists
  b89be11... layout: Handle empty attr lists like NULL ones

Commits added to the branch:

  b732847... tests/test-break.c: Only test Thai breaks with libthai avai (*)
  631775d... Update Grapheme and Word Boundary to Unicode 13 (*)
  2ac5775... Update gen-break-table.py for Unicode 13 (*)
  23b6d06... Update Line Breaking to Unicode 13 (*)
  145e303... Update pango-break-table.h to Unicode 13 (*)
  9d76aa6... Update break test cases to Unicode 13 (*)
  3981fff... build: Require glib 2.60 (*)
  0b3cd20... Replace fallthrough comments with G_GNUC_FALLTHROUGH (*)
  3a9398f... PangoLanguage: Fix clang -Wcast-align warnings (*)
  86b6c96... build: add a wrap file for harfbuzz (*)
  17b79d2... Replace deprecated bugzilla.gnome.org URL with gitlab.gnome (*)
  8336ecd... CI: Switch to new Windows runners (*)
  ff5d158... Merge branch 'new-win32-runners' into 'master' (*)
  d650992... Docs: improve formatting of markup description (*)
  be05ecd... Merge branch 'harfbuzz-subproject' into 'master' (*)
  f59acff... win32: Use GPrivate-managed display device context (*)
  e48ae52... Merge branch 'master' into 'master' (*)
  10307fd... meson: Only use FreeType fallback only when needed (*)
  fc5e8c1... Visual Studio: Use -utf-8 when available (*)
  45b5780... meson: Fix pkg-config file generation for HarfBuzz (*)
  9774cb2... Merge branch 'msvc.improvements' into 'master' (*)
  f1ad230... Add API to compare PangoAttrLists (*)
  a47f958... win32: Use GPrivate-managed display device context (*)
  94ac19e... meson: Only use FreeType fallback only when needed (*)
  bf84f87... Visual Studio: Use -utf-8 when available (*)
  fb2d898... meson: Fix pkg-config file generation for HarfBuzz (*)
  475e2d7... pangowin32-fontmap: load windows fallbacks and aliases in c (*)
  a56ef2b... pangowin32-fontmap: delete no longer needed font map aliase (*)
  220905c... Merge branch 'win32_font_corruption' into 'master' (*)
  4c44845... Merge branch 'unicode13' into 'master' (*)
  5423136... Merge branch 'master' into 'master' (*)
  7310356... Merge branch 'wip/tbaederr/clang-warnings' into 'master' (*)
  dd867f4... renderer: Fix a division-by-zero (*)
  a9d4536... Merge branch 'add-compare-attr-lists' into 'master' (*)
  8ba28ca... Merge branch 'fix-error-underline' into 'master' (*)
  a0f8967... Merge branch 'doc_tweak' into 'master' (*)
  78499e8... Merge branch 'test-break-no-libthai' into 'master' (*)
  db338d3... layout: Ignore setting the width if it won't have any effec
  e36f7e4... pangocairo-context: Don't invalidate if font options are eq
  7d57ea0... layout: Try to avoid some work when creating iters
  8a3609f... Allocate internal PangoAttrListIterators on the stack
  51ff076... layotu: Avoid invalidating when setting attrs from NULL to 
  346c064... layout: Add missing (nullable) annotation
  9530151... Allocate internal PangoAttrLists on the stack
  d8e5dab... layout: Avoid getting the text length if we know it already
  faba03e... attributes: Add _pango_attr_list_has_attributes
  d69027c... break_attrs: Bail out if we have no ALLOW_BREAKS attributes
  4306b2b... break: Make a local const
  fe10183... break: Only call break_attrs if we really have attributes
  c51fb7e... glyph-item: Allocate attr iterator on the stack
  e66d0d9... testattributes: Properly free GString
  3e8c675... attrs: Save iterator stack in a GPtrArray
  4293557... attrlist: Remove attributes_tail
  44bc4a9... attrs: Save attribute list in a GPtrArray
  304ddc2... testattributes: Test iter on empty attr list
  851707f... pango-layout: Try to avoid allocating a new PangoAttrList
  9f8ae53... layout: Unconditionally unref attr lists
  5294519... test-common: Ignore null attr lists
  e9a9e28... layout: Handle empty attr lists like NULL ones
  2ada620... attributes: Rename attributes2 back to attributes
  a0905a2... attrs: Remove unused iterator member

(*) This commit already existed in another branch; no separate mail sent


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]